Noun pnoē (breath, wind) in the Gospels-Acts

(Translation from NRSV)


Acts

2: 2And suddenly from heaven there came a sound like the rush of a violent wind (pnoē), and it filled the entire house where they were sitting.
17: 25nor is he served by human hands, as though he needed anything, since he himself gives to all mortals life and breath (pnoē) and all things.
